计算机专业打代码通常涉及以下步骤和技巧:
选择编程语言
根据项目需求选择合适的编程语言,如Python、Java、C++、C等。每种语言都有其特定的应用场景和语法规则,需要熟悉并掌握。
学习编程基础
学习编程语言的基本语法、数据类型、控制结构(如条件语句、循环语句)、函数和类(面向对象编程)等。这些是编写程序的基础。
设计算法
对于需要实现的功能,首先通过算法来描述其实现过程。算法是指导计算机运行程序的步骤序列,需要考虑正确性、效率和可行性。
编写代码
根据设计好的算法,选择合适的编程环境和IDE(集成开发环境),将算法转化为计算机可执行的程序。在编写代码时,要注意代码的结构、可读性和简洁性,以便于后续的调试和维护。
调试和测试
编写完成代码后,需要对程序进行调试和测试,排除代码中的错误,确保程序的正确性、健壮性和高效性。可以使用调试工具、单元测试和集成测试等方法。
优化性能
如果程序的性能不足,可以通过优化代码、减少资源消耗、使用更高效的算法和数据结构等方法来提高程序的性能。
发布部署
完成测试后,将程序发布和部署到目标计算机系统中,让用户使用。这可能涉及软件的打包、安装和配置等步骤。
持续学习和实践
编程是一个不断学习和实践的过程。需要不断学习新技术和方法,跟上编程语言和开发环境的更新,通过实际项目来巩固和提升编程能力。
打代码的硬件和软件准备
设备配置:确保笔记本电脑配置足够高,包括处理器、内存、硬盘空间和显示器等,以支持编程和开发工作。
编程软件:选择合适的编程软件和IDE,如IntelliJ IDEA、Eclipse、Visual Studio Code等,这些工具提供了编码、调试和运行程序的综合平台。
快捷键:熟练掌握常用快捷键可以显著提高编程效率,例如Ctrl+C(复制)、Ctrl+V(粘贴)、Ctrl+D(复制当前行或选中的代码块)等。
编程习惯:养成良好的编程习惯,如代码缩进、注释、命名规范等,这有助于提高代码的可读性和可维护性。
通过以上步骤和技巧,计算机专业的学生可以有效地打代码,并逐步提升自己的编程能力。